The Echo of a Lost Love
The s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den hue over the ancient castle. Inside, the grand hall was a sea of faces, each one a part of the grand tapestry of the kingdom. Yet, amidst the revelry, there was a lone figure, a knight named Elion, whose heart was as heavy as the armor he wore.
Elion had always been the beacon of hope, the knight who had saved the kingdom from countless threats. But tonight, his eyes were filled with a pain that no sword could wound. For he had discovered that the woman he loved, Aria, was not who she claimed to be.
Aria had been the voice of reason, the one who had guided Elion through the darkest of times. She was the reason he fought, the reason he lived. But now, he learned that she was a spy, sent by the enemy to betray the kingdom.
The revelation had shattered Elion's world. He had seen the love in her eyes, the trust that had grown between them, and now it was all a lie. He had given his heart to a woman who had no intention of being his true love.
As the night wore on, Elion found himself alone in the silent halls of the castle. The weight of his armor seemed to press down on him, each piece a reminder of the love he had lost and the duty he had to fulfill. He knew that he could not let his emotions cloud his judgment, that he had to protect the kingdom he had sworn to serve.
In the quiet of the night, Elion's thoughts turned to the past. He remembered the day they had met, the way her smile had lit up the room, the way her laughter had filled his heart. He remembered the battles they had fought together, the way they had stood side by side, their trust unwavering.
But as the memories flooded back, so did the pain. He realized that the love he had felt for Aria was real, that it had been genuine. And now, he was forced to face the truth: the love that had brought him joy was the same love that could bring the kingdom to its knees.
Elion knew that he had to make a choice. He could allow his love for Aria to consume him, to drive him to do things he would regret. Or he could do what was right for the kingdom, even if it meant sacrificing the love he held so dear.
In the depths of his soul, Elion found the strength to rise above his emotions. He knew that he could not let his heart dictate his actions, that he had to think with his head. He knew that he had to protect the kingdom, even if it meant betraying the woman he loved.
As dawn approached, Elion stood before the king, his face calm and resolute. He revealed the truth about Aria, and the king, understanding the gravity of the situation, ordered Elion to execute his duty and protect the kingdom.
Elion knew that this would be the hardest battle of his life. He would have to face Aria, to see the betrayal in her eyes, to hear the lies that she had told. He would have to watch her fall, to watch the love he had once held for her fade away.
But Elion also knew that this was the only way to ensure the safety of the kingdom. He knew that he had to be the knight that the people needed him to be, even if it meant sacrificing the love that had defined him.
As he prepared to face Aria, Elion felt a pang of sorrow. He realized that the love he had felt for her was real, that it had been a part of him for so long. But he also knew that he could not let his love cloud his judgment, that he had to protect the kingdom above all else.
In the end, Elion faced Aria, and as he watched her fall, he knew that he had made the right choice. He had chosen duty over love, and in doing so, he had found a new purpose. He had found the strength to continue being the knight that the kingdom needed him to be.
And so, as the sun rose, casting a new day upon the kingdom, Elion stood tall, his armor gleaming in the morning light. He knew that he had made the right choice, that he had chosen the greater good. And as he looked out over the land he had sworn to protect, he knew that the love he had once held for Aria had not been in vain. It had been a part of him, a part of his journey, and now, it had led him to a new beginning.
